构建一个视频H5页面需要哪种类型的服务器支持?

视频的H5页面需要一个支持流媒体传输和高并发访问的服务器。这样的服务器需要具备足够的带宽、存储空间和处理能力,以应对大量用户同时观看视频的需求。

随着技术的发展,视频服务成为互联网内容的重要组成部分,H5视频播放器因其跨平台和易于嵌入的特性而广受欢迎,但实现高效、流畅的视频服务,选择合适的服务器技术是关键,下面将基于现有信息,探索适合视频H5页面的服务器要求和相关技术细节:

视频的h5需要什么服务器
(图片来源网络,侵删)

1、服务器的视频编解码支持

视频编解码的重要性:为保证视频文件在传输和播放过程中的稳定性及流畅性,服务器必须支持视频编码和解码功能,这是因为视频数据通常体积较大,未经编码的视频流会导致数据传输缓慢,播放时出现卡顿。

编解码技术选择:市面上存在多种视频编解码技术如H.264、H.265(HEVC)、VP9等,其中H.264由于其广泛的支持和良好的压缩效率而被普遍采用,选择正确的编码格式对于保证视频质量和播放兼容性至关重要。

2、流媒体服务器的应用

流媒体服务器的作用:流媒体服务器专注于优化和传输多媒体数据,如音频和视频,这些服务器针对实时性和高数据传输速率的需求进行了优化,非常适合于视频点播、直播等场景。

视频的h5需要什么服务器
(图片来源网络,侵删)

RTSP与H5的结合:虽然H5原生并不支持RTSP(RealTime Streaming Protocol),RTSP却因其卓越的实时性能被广泛应用于视频监控和在线直播系统,当使用H5进行类似功能的实现时,可能需要服务器端支持转换或桥接RTSP流到H5兼容的媒体流。

3、流行的视频播放插件

Video.js的功能优势:Video.js是一个开源的HTML5视频播放器库,提供了丰富的API和自定义选项,支持多种浏览器和设备,这使得开发者可以更加灵活地控制视频播放体验,例如添加字幕、调节播放速度等。

4、前端视频播放的优化

自动播放及其影响:在某些应用场景中,视频需要自动播放,这不仅能提升用户体验,还能在广告等商业应用中吸引用户注意,自动播放需考虑到数据消耗和页面加载速度的影响。

视频的h5需要什么服务器
(图片来源网络,侵删)

跨平台兼容性处理:不同的浏览器和设备对视频格式和编解码器的支持不尽相同,因此在部署视频H5时,确保视频内容能够在多平台上顺利播放,是设计和测试阶段需要重点考虑的问题。

保障视频内容的高可用性和快速响应,不仅仅依赖服务器端的优化,也涉及到网络传输的优化,使用内容分发网络(CDN)可以缓存视频内容于地理位置更接近用户的位置,从而减少延迟和提升播放质量,考虑到安全性,尤其是涉及用户生成内容的视频服务,服务器还需要集成相应的安全策略防止恶意软件注入和数据泄露。

构建一个高效、可靠的H5视频播放服务涉及多个方面,从选择合适的服务器硬件和软件,到优化前端代码,再到利用现代网络技术优化数据传输,每一个环节都是确保视频内容能够高质量、安全、快速地送达用户的关键,随着技术的不断进步和用户需求的增加,未来可能会出现更多创新的解决方案,以进一步优化视频播放体验。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-07-23 20:50
下一篇 2024-07-23 21:00

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信